Product overviewPersonal alarm dosimeters are designed for medical personnel working with ionizing radiation. The device provides real-time dose rate monitoring and alarm notification when preset thresholds are exceeded. Compact and suitable for continuous personal monitoring, with Bluetooth connectivity for data transfer to a mobile phone or compatible application.
Technical parameters- Detector type: scintillation detector
- Sensitivity: 11 cps / μSv/h
- Range: 0.01 μSv/h - 100 mSv/h
- Response time: <8 s
- Relative inherent error: ≤ ±20%
- Size: 60 mm x 46 mm x 20 mm
- Communication: Bluetooth connection to mobile phone
Application fields- Department of Radiology: The Department of Radiology is a comprehensive unit integrating diagnostic imaging and interventional procedures. Radiological diagnosis uses X-rays, gamma rays and other ionizing radiation to produce images of internal structures on detectors or films, enabling assessment of anatomy, physiological function and pathological lesions.
- Department of Radiation Oncology: Radiation oncology uses localized ionizing radiation for cancer treatment. Sources include alpha, beta and gamma emissions from radioisotopes, as well as X-rays, electron beams and particle beams produced by therapy units and medical accelerators.
- Department of Nuclear Medicine: This department applies nuclear techniques for diagnosis and therapy. Combining imaging, therapeutic services, research and teaching, it is a core modality in modern clinical practice.
